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ations
- Skin type and hydration: Look for formulas with humectants like hyaluronic acid or hydrating ingredients (shea butter, glycerin) to prevent crepey skin from drying out.
- Color correction vs. coverage: Pink or peach-tinted brightenings neutralize blue under-eyes, while beige or nude tones provide coverage without tint shifting. Choose depending on your primary concern (dark circles vs. overall discoloration).
- Texture and finish: For crepey skin, a lightweight, creamy, or gel-based concealer with a satin finish tends to crease less than thick liquids or mats. A good primer can also help.
- Wear and longevity: Water-resistant or long-wear formulas help maintain brightness through humidity or long days, reducing the need for touch-ups.
- Shade range: Ensure shade options cover both pink-toned brighteners and more neutral tones to avoid ashy appearances on warmer skin.
- Application method: Many crepey-skin users prefer brush or finger application for controlled blending; some products double as primers for a seamless base.
- Safety and ethics: Consider vegan, cruelty-free, and paraben-free options if you prefer such formulations.
Comparative Notes
- Brighteners with hyaluronic acid and shea butter tend to hydrate and cushion the under-eye area, reducing the look of creases.
- Color-correcting pinks are effective for blue-toned circles but may require a neutralizer for deeper discoloration.
- Gently set crepey under-eyes with a light-handed dusting of translucent powder to avoid cakiness, or skip powder for a dewier look.
- Consider pairing a brightening concealer with a dedicated eye cream for mature skin to maximize comfort and longevity.
